Parasitoids of Cerroneuroterus yukawamasudai (Hymenoptera: Cynipidae) and Biology Characteristics of Torymus sp., a Predominent Parasitic Species on the Gall Wasp

Abstract:

Objective: The present study aims to clarify the species of the parasitoids in the galls of Cerroneuroterus yukawamasudai and deconstruct the biological characteristics of the predominant parasitoid species, so as to provide a scientific basis for biocontrol of the gall wasp. Method: Species of parasitoids and biology of a dominant parasitoid Torymus sp. in the asexual gall of C . yukawamasudai were surveyed by field investigation, indoor anatomy and laboratory experiment. Result: There were three parasitoid species in the asexual gall of C. yukawamasudai : Torymus sp., Pteromalus sp. and Chouioia sp. Among them, Torymus sp. was predominant parasitic natural enemy. The parasitoid occurred one generation in a year, and the larvae overwintered in the host asexual galls. The overwintering adults of Torymus sp. started emergence in late October, and laid eggs in the asexual galls. The parasitism rates of Torymus sp. to C . yukawamasudai were 18.00% and 21.86% in 2019 and 2020, respectively. Eclosion period of the parasitoid lasted for 81–85 days. Peak eclosion periods of male and female parasitoid were in mid-November and late November, respectively. The eclosion time was concentrated between 8:00–12:00 in every day, and its sex ratio (female/male) was 1︰2. The parasitic wasp was good at jumping and had the habit of feign death. Adults could mate on the same day after they emerged from the gall, and mated multiple times. Honey water supplementation significantly extended the longevity of male parasitoid, but not female parasitoid. Conclusion: Torymus sp., Pteromalus sp. and Chouioia sp. are found in the galls of the asexual galls of C. yukawamasudai . Parasitism rate of Torymus sp. to C. yukawamasudai is the highest, stating that Torymus sp. is the dominant species of parasitic natural enemies. Torymus sp. can be used as an important means to control C. yukawamasudai.
